OPINION

CRUMLISH, Jr., Senior Judge.

John B. McCue, Robert F. Burkardt and William C. Fisher (claimants) appeal a State Employees' Retirement Board (Board) order denying their requests to purchase retirement credits for active military service. We affirm.
